Urban Press 2012 “Due Vigne” or two vines has 70% Petite Verdot, 30% Cabernet Sauvignon, grown in Paso Robles. Two perfect roses, photographed in black and white, lay on a rustic wood table. One, with a heart-shaped center. Delicate yet durable, fragrant and multi-layered. This blend has a perfect balance of acidity, body, juiciness and flavor. Aged for 14 months in new French oak, this blend has ripe blueberry presents on the nose and initial palate which eases smoothly into a juicy, mellow finish that lingers.
